The Minster And The Spiritual Life is a book written by Frank W. Gunsaulus and first published in 1911. The book is an exploration of the role of the minister in guiding the spiritual lives of their congregation. Gunsaulus argues that the minister must be a leader who is able to inspire and guide their flock towards a deeper understanding of their faith and a closer relationship with God. Throughout the book, Gunsaulus draws on his own experiences as a minister and his extensive knowledge of theology and philosophy to offer practical advice on how to cultivate a strong spiritual life. He emphasizes the importance of prayer, meditation, and regular study of scripture as essential components of a healthy spiritual life. Gunsaulus also explores the challenges that ministers face in their work, including the pressures of modern life and the need to balance their professional responsibilities with their personal lives. He offers insights on how to maintain a sense of balance and focus in the midst of these challenges, and how to remain true to one's calling as a spiritual leader.
